The JE Dunn Has Heart Challenge is a shared expression of compassion, connection, and commitment to a healthier tomorrow. Created to raise both donations and awareness for the American Heart Association, this annual challenge unites JE Dunn employees from across the country around a common purpose: supporting heart health while strengthening our sense of community.
What began in Kansas City as a solo effort by Dan West, a 35-year JE Dunn veteran, has become a drive to bring people together through movement, camaraderie, and care for one another. Over the years, that vision has grown into a nationwide effort, inspiring teams across all JE Dunn offices to run, walk, or cycle together in support of healthier hearts and hopeful futures.
Between June 1st and June 5th, 2026, each local office will coordinate its own “leg” of the challenge, contributing to a collective journey that reflects the strength of our people and the impact we can make when we move as one. By taking part in the JE Dunn Has Heart Challenge, employees honor a legacy of wellness, teamwork, and giving back—one step, one pedal, and one stride at a time.
